MARCDrivingAwardsProgram If you are a participant in theMARC Driving Awards Program, please provide yourmileage as ofDecember31,2017totheShadeTreeA’sDrivingCoordinator,RobbieJones.MileagemustbesubmittedbeforeFebruary28,2018sogetitinassoonaspossible.IfyouareamemberofMARCandhaveneverregisteredfortheprogramandwouldliketoparticipate,contactRobbieforaregistrationcardatthefollowingemailaddress:

[email protected]$1.00isrequiredandtheprogramisopentoallMARCmembers.Thefirstawardisgivenat2,000milesandevery5,000milesthereafter.Mileagedoesnothavetobeearnedallinoneyearandcanaccumulatefromyeartoyear.Additionalinformationonthepro-gramcanbefoundontheMARCwebsiteat:

ThethemefortheFebruary1988issueoftheShadeTreeA’sNewsletterseemedtobetriviaandriddles.What do “Geargrinders” and “Fender Benders” have in common? These were two of the namesconsideredbytheShadeTreeA’sfoundingfathersforthenameoftheClub.Othernamesconsideredincluded“TheCSRA’s”,NorthAugustaA’s”,PalmettoA’s”andjustplain“A’s”.

Another riddle concerned finding names of automobilesfromcluessuchas:- Thenameofaplanet(Mercury)- TheSpanishwordforariver(Reo)- Toduckwhensomeonetriestostrikeyou(Dodge)- Afamousrock(Plymouth)Andofcourse,whatearlypioneersdidwhentheycametoastream(Ford).

AnswertotheNewsletterTriviaQuestion:1927ModelAFord

Notuntil1927,withtheintroductionoftheModelA,didaFordautomobile roll off an assembly line at the Rougecomplex.(fromtheHemmingsDaily)
